SUMMARY
Responsible for maintaining and managing the daily accounts receivable function of the company function of the company. Primary duties include tracking and recording payments from customers, resolving discrepancies, ensuring the timely collection of outstanding invoices and maintaining accurate financial records. Collaborates closely with other departments, such as sales, finance and customer service, to streamline processes.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
· Investigates issues related to non-payment of outstanding invoices and payment discrepancies and initiates the required action for resolution.
· Implement collection strategies to minimize outstanding balances.
· Support month-end and year-end close processes by reconciling AR accounts.
· Generate and distribute invoices accurately and on time, as well as reminder notices as necessary.
· Monitor accounts receivable aging and identify overdue accounts.
· Provides information as required for management reporting.
· Maintains positive working relationships with internal and external customers.
· Advises collectors and/or management of payment issues and recommends corrective action.
· Prioritizes and handles multiple tasks simultaneously.
· Periodically assists the Accounts Receivable team with collecting invoice payments.
